首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何将tuple添加为(key,tuple) map的值?

将tuple添加为(key,tuple) map的值,可以使用以下步骤:

  1. 创建一个空的(key,tuple) map。在大多数编程语言中,可以使用类似于dict()HashMap()的数据结构来实现。
  2. 创建一个tuple,包含要添加的数据。
  3. 指定一个唯一的key,该key将与tuple关联。
  4. 将tuple作为值与该key一起插入到map中。根据编程语言的不同,可以使用类似于map[key] = valuemap.put(key, value)的语法进行插入操作。

示例(使用Python语言):

代码语言:txt
复制
# 步骤1:创建一个空的(key,tuple) map
my_map = dict()

# 步骤2:创建一个tuple,包含要添加的数据
my_tuple = (1, 2, 3)

# 步骤3:指定一个唯一的key
my_key = 'example_key'

# 步骤4:将tuple作为值与该key一起插入到map中
my_map[my_key] = my_tuple

完成以上步骤后,你就成功地将一个tuple添加为(key,tuple) map的值了。需要注意的是,map中的key必须是唯一的,否则会覆盖已存在的值。

关于腾讯云相关产品和产品介绍的链接,可以参考腾讯云官方文档或官方网站,根据具体需求选择相应的产品。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

【Groovy】map 集合 ( 根据 Key 获取 map 集合中对应 | map.Key 方式 | map.‘Key’ 方式 | map 方式 | 代码示例 )

文章目录 一、根据 Key 获取 map 集合中对应 1、通过 map.Key 方式获取 map 集合中 Value 2、通过 map.'...Key' 方式获取 map 集合中 Value 3、通过 map['Key'] 方式获取 map 集合中 Value 二、完整代码示例 一、根据 Key 获取 map 集合中对应 ----...‘Key’ 方式获取 map 集合中 Value ; 方式 3 : 通过 map[‘Key’] 方式获取 map 集合中 Value ; 1、通过 map.Key 方式获取 map 集合中...‘Key’ 方式获取 map 集合中 Value 通过 map....G' 执行结果 : Java Kotlin Groovy 3、通过 map[‘Key’] 方式获取 map 集合中 Value 通过 map[‘Key’] 方式 , 获取 map 集合中 Key 对应

13.7K30
  • Map中获取key-value方法

    Map集合是一种键值映射形式集合。当调用put(Kkey,V value)方法把数据存到Map中后,那么如何把Mapkey和value取出来呢?都有哪几种取值方法呢?下边就来一介绍一下。...一、前置准备 以HashMap:为例,先为map中存几个数据,以便于后边对map遍历取值。 二、获取Mapkey-value。...获取MapKkey-value分别有以下几种方式,使用时可以根据不同场景,选择对应取值方式。 方法一:同时获取Mapkey和value。...此方法通常用在要遍历展示这个map中所有的key和value 在主方法中调用这个获取key和value方法: 控制台显示 方法二: 获取Map所有key,以及通过key获取对应value...在主方法中调用这个获取key方法: 控制台显示 方法三: 获取Map所有value,此方法通常用于只想要展示或获取所有的vaue情况。

    9.8K40

    Flink —— 状态

    所有支持状态类型如下所示: ValueState: 保存一个可以更新和检索(如上所述,每个都对应到当前输入数据 key,因此算子接收到每个 key 都可能对应一个)。...你可以添加键值对到状态中,也可以获得反映当前所有映射迭代器。使用 put(UK,UV) 或者 putAll(Map) 添加映射。 使用 get(UK) 检索特定 key。...另外需要牢记是从状态中获取取决于输入元素所代表 key。 因此,在不同 key 上调用同一个接口,可能得到不同。 你必须创建一个 StateDescriptor,才能得到对应状态句柄。...,展示了如何将这些部分组合起来: public class CountWindowAverage extends RichFlatMapFunction, Tuple2...当前开启 TTL map state 仅在用户序列化器支持 null 情况下,才支持用户为 null。

    97310

    Spark性能优化之道——解决Spark数据倾斜(Data Skew)N种姿势

    ,使用自定义Partitioner,使用Map侧Join代替Reduce侧Join,给倾斜Key加上随机前缀等。...比如一台机器负责处理80%任务,另外两台机器各处理10%任务,如下图所示。 ? 在上图中,机器数据增加为三倍,但执行时间只降为原来80%,远低于理想。   ...,一般相当于一个Block大小(在Hadoop 2中,默认为128MB),所以数据倾斜问题不明显。...案例 现有一张测试表,名为student_external,内有10.5亿条数据,每条数据有一个唯一id。...然后将不包含倾斜Key剩余数据进行Join。最后将两次Join结果集通过union合并,即可得到全部Join结果。 优势 相对于Map则Join,更能适应大数据集Join。

    2.2K101

    Transformers 4.37 中文文档(四十七)

    如果您想要更多控制如何将input_ids索引转换为关联向量,而不是模型内部嵌入查找矩阵,则这很有用。 output_hidden_states(布尔,可选)— 是否返回所有层隐藏状态。...包含预先计算隐藏状态(自注意力块和交叉注意力块中键和),可用于加速顺序解码(请参见past_key_values输入)。...包含预先计算隐藏状态(自注意力块和交叉注意力块中键和),可用于加速顺序解码(请参见past_key_values输入)。...包含预先计算隐藏状态(自注意力块和交叉注意力块中键和),可用于加速顺序解码(请参见past_key_values输入)。...包含预先计算隐藏状态(自注意力块和交叉注意力块中键和),可用于加速顺序解码(参见past_key_values输入)。

    15410

    Python基础——PyCharm版本——第三章、数据类型和变量(超详细)

    其他获取元素方法和list是一样。 不可变tuple有什么意义?因为tuple不可变,所以代码更安全。如果可能,能用tuple代替list就尽量用tuple。...---- 练习 请问以下变量哪些是tuple类型:(a、d、e)  a = ()  b = (1)  c = [2]  d = (3,)  e = (4,5,6) 字典 字典中使用键(key)/(value...键可以是数字、字符串甚至是元组;可以是任意数据类型。 字典使用{}组织元素。 字典使用”字典名[键]” 来访问对应。 字典中键是唯一,而可以不唯一。...同列表一样,字典中也可以是其他子字典或是子列表。 map={"河北":"石家庄","黑龙江":"哈尔滨"} print(map) 读取是可以根据mapkey进行。...map={"河北":"石家庄","黑龙江":"哈尔滨"} print(map) print(map.get("河北")) 添加mapkey与value map={"河北":"石家庄","黑龙江":"

    48730

    transformation操作开发实战

    算子,将集合中每个元素都乘以2 // map算子,是对任何类型RDD,都可以调用 // 在java中,map算子接收参数是Function对象 // 创建Function对象,一定会让你设置第二个泛型参数...Function2类型,它有三个泛型参数,实际上代表了三个 // 第一个泛型类型和第二个泛型类型,代表了原始RDD中元素value类型 ​​​// 因此对每个key进行reduce,都会依次将第一个...第三个泛型类型,代表了每次reduce操作返回类型,默认也是与原始RDDvalue类型相同 ​​// reduceByKey算法返回RDD,还是JavaPairRDD...进行join,并返回JavaPairRDD ​​// 但是JavaPairRDD第一个泛型类型是之前两个JavaPairRDDkey类型,因为是通过key进行join ​​// 第二个泛型类型,...是Tuple2类型,Tuple2两个泛型分别为原始RDDvalue类型 ​​// join,就返回RDD每一个元素,就是通过key join上一个pair ​​// 什么意思呢

    50320

    python有序列表_python有序列表以及方法介绍(代码)

    末尾 list.append(‘admin’) # pop删除指定位置元素 list.pop(len(list)-1) # insert指定位置插入元素 #两个参数 1.要插入位置 2.插入内容...= second) list.sort(key = second,reverse = True) operator模块 比较两个列表元素import operator operator.lt(a,b...#chr 数字转字符串 max 和 min#max返回列表最大,list元素必须为同一类型,返回最大 #max返回列表最小,list元素必须为同一类型,返回最小 #数字直接比较大小 字符串比较...97 98,99 100 #cd ab list函数和tuple函数将无序集合转为列表,只转换最外1层 list((1, 2, 3, (4, 5))) #[1, 2, 3, (4, 5)] 将列表转为无序集合...,只转换最外1层 tuple([1, 2, 3, [4, 5]]) # (1, 2, 3, [4, 5]) 发布者:全栈程序员栈长,转载请注明出处:https://javaforall.cn/149329

    71220
    领券